In order to implement the organizational change, first, the organization
needs to make a change in individual human resource. Human resource is the
main key to achieve some change in organizational behavior. But, there is also
some condition that makes the employee resist the change. Based on the Robbins
(2016), The main reasons that make the people resist to change include
uncertainty, habit, concern over a personal loss, and the belief that the change is
not in the organization’s best interest.

Third, managing the change efficiently and effectively. Change is constant


in every organization, but the employees fastly being the number one opposite of
the change that the organization makes. The main reason why they are being the
number one opposite of the change happened in the organization is bad managing
change in the workplace. Employees distrust in the organization's managing
change are the main factor. How the change process itself is communicated to the
employees is very important because it determines how they react. If the process
of what needs to be changed, how it needs to be changed and what success would
look like cannot be communicated, then resistance should be expected. Employees
need to understand why there is a need for change because if they are just thrown
the notion that what they have been used for a long time is going to be completely
renovated, with that will come much backlash.
